What is Body Intelligence?
Only one of my favourite topics in the world!
Body intelligence is your ability to notice and respond to the messages your body sends you. Itโs your inner compass - guiding you through energy dips, emotional waves, intuitive nudges and physical cues. Itโs the deep knowing of what feels safe, what brings you peace, and what energises you from the inside out.
The truth is, we all have this wisdom. But in our noisy, overstimulated world, it often gets buried under layers of to-do lists, notifications, people-pleasing, and productivity hacks.
This is why so many of us feel tired, disconnected, overwhelmed โฆ and why we canโt figure out why!
The Good News?
You can come back home to yourself. You can rebuild trust with your body. You can strengthen your own unique interoception (the ability to sense and interpret your internal state). And you donโt need an app, a techy watch, a diagnosis, or a degree in neuroscience to do it.
You just need to slow down enough to notice.
Some Simple Tools I Share to Help You Reconnect With Your Body
1. White Space Moments
Start by creating small pockets of nothingness. A few minutes with no agenda, no phone, no stimulation. Just you, your breath, and your body.
Maybe itโs sitting with a warm drink and just sipping in silence. Maybe itโs a walk with no podcast. Maybe itโs closing your eyes in the car before going inside. White space creates room for your bodyโs signals to be heard.
2. Notice Before You React
Before jumping into your next task, decision or snack โฆ pause. Ask: What am I actually feeling right now? What do I need?
This practice builds the muscle of awareness. Over time, youโll start to notice your patterns. What triggers stress, what brings calm, how you self-soothe, and how you ignore your needs (we all do it!).
3. Move Slowly, On Purpose
It doesnโt have to be a full 90 minute yoga flow or a run. Gentle movement like stretching, swaying, or walking with intention gives your body a chance to speak. It lets you feel whatโs tight, whatโs tender, whatโs tired - and when youโre ready for more.
Reconnecting with your body isnโt about perfection. Itโs not about having all the answers. Itโs about getting curious. Itโs about remembering that your body is always communicating with you - you just have to make space to listen.
